logo

Output 72016a2505f4f1c4d98afb4fe650752146e6977620f34a70d8d987867b5172e0:1

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aa609175a0def2f0e7be0a357f0e757e8f4c955 OP_EQUALVERIFY OP_CHECKSIG
address
13RuULZWXurV5b8oQcDWZqseKmjKuauNQx
transaction
72016a2505f4f1c4d98afb4fe650752146e6977620f34a70d8d987867b5172e0